Name: reactive oxygen species
Synonyms: ROS
Definition: Molecules or ions formed by the incomplete one-electron reduction of oxygen. They contribute to the microbicidal activity of phagocytes, regulation of signal transduction and gene expression, and the oxidative damage to biopolymers.
Ontology: ChEBI [CHEBI:26523]  ( EBI )
